Phase Plate Cryo-Em Structure Of Formylpeptide Receptor 2 Bound To An Inhibitory G Protein

摘要
Formylpeptide receptors (FPRs) are pattern recognition G protein-coupled receptors that can recognize formylpeptides derived from pathogens or host cells. In addition, they can also recognize structurally and functionally distinct peptides and lipids to either promote or resolve inflammation. The molecular mechanisms underlying the pattern recognition and multifaceted signaling of FPRs are not clear. Here we report a cryo-EM structure of formylpeptide receptor 2 (FPR2) and Gi complex with a peptide agonist. The structure reveals a widely open extracellular region with an amphiphilic environment, providing a structural basis for promiscuous ligand recognition. Together with computational docking and simulation, the structure suggests molecular mechanisms for the pattern recognition of formylpeptides by FPRs and receptor activation by diverse agonists and reveals conserved and divergent features in Gi coupling.
